Renewable and low carbon energy planning policy review consultation

News article

Draft revised policy consultation document for strategic planning policy on renewable and low carbon energy open for comment.

The Department for Infrastructure (DfI) has published a draft revised policy consultation document for strategic planning policy on renewable and low carbon energy.

The aim of the review is to ensure that regional strategic planning policy on renewable and low carbon energy remains fit for purpose and up-to-date to inform decision-making in relation to development proposals for this subject area. It is also intended to inform the local development plan (LDP) process and enable plan-makers to bring forward appropriate local policies, all within the wider contemporary context for energy and the climate emergency.
